Housing base,nominal Current: 12 A,rated Voltage (III/2): 320 V,N. º poles: 23,Pitch: 5 mm,Color: whitish green,contact Surface: Tin,Assembly: wave Soldering

Printed circuit board base housing, nominal section: 2.5 mm², color: whitish green, nominal current: 12 A, nominal voltage (III/2): 320 V, contact surface: Tin, contact connection type: Male, number of potentials: 23, number of rows: 1, number of poles: 23, number of connections: 23, article family: BCH-H, pitch: 5 mm, mounting: Wave soldering, pin arrangement: Linear pin arrangement, pin length [P]: 3.5 mm, number of solder pins per potential: 1, plug-in system: BASICLINE 2.5, Plug-in face orientation: Standard, lock: without, fixing type: without, packaging type: boxed

Operating InformationMINICONNEC connectors are connectors without switching power (COC) in accordance with DIN EN 61984. When used correctly, they should not be plugged in or disconnected if they are under load or powered on.
